[發明專利]數據傳輸方法、裝置和服務器有效
| 申請號: | 201410746563.5 | 申請日: | 2014-12-08 |
| 公開(公告)號: | CN104468399B | 公開(公告)日: | 2020-01-17 |
| 發明(設計)人: | 楊濤;侯金軒 | 申請(專利權)人: | 北京奇虎科技有限公司;奇智軟件(北京)有限公司 |
| 主分類號: | H04L12/861 | 分類號: | H04L12/861 |
| 代理公司: | 11348 北京鼎佳達知識產權代理事務所(普通合伙) | 代理人: | 王偉鋒;劉鐵生 |
| 地址: | 100088 北京市西城區新*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據傳輸 方法 裝置 服務器 | ||
本發明公開了一種數據傳輸方法、裝置和服務器,主要涉及互聯網技術領域,主要目的在于防止數據傳輸過程中丟失數據。方法包括:在第一服務器所處的地理位置,接收來自第一服務器的待發送至第二服務器的數據,第二服務器和第一服務器位于不同地理位置;將數據存放到預設的隊列中;從隊列中獲取數據,并將數據發送到第二服務器;判斷數據是否成功發送到第二服務器;在數據發送失敗時,重新從隊列中獲取數據并進行發送。根據本發明的技術方案,可以有效地防止出現數據丟失的情況。
技術領域
本發明涉及互聯網技術領域,具體而言,涉及一種數據傳輸方法、裝置和服務器。
背景技術
通過互聯網進行大量數據的傳輸,如何保證所傳輸數據的準確性是一個重要的課題。
比較常見的一個例子是:游戲廠商的服務器設置在北京機房,用于運行游戲程序;數據分析商的服務器設置在上海機房,用于對游戲數據進行分析;所以需要將北京機房服務器的游戲數據發送到上海機房服務器進行數據分析。北京與上海兩地之間的公網網絡如果出現了故障,就必然會造成大量數據傳輸丟失。而北京、上海兩地的公網網絡質量,并非游戲廠商或數據分析商可以進行掌控的,這就造成需要面臨數據丟失的難題。
發明內容
鑒于上述問題,提出了本發明以便提供一種克服上述問題或者至少部分地解決上述問題的數據傳輸方法、裝置和服務器。
依據本發明的一個方面,提供了一種數據傳輸方法,其包括:在第一服務器所處的地理位置,接收來自所述第一服務器的待發送至第二服務器的數據,所述第二服務器和所述第一服務器位于不同地理位置;將所述數據存放到預設的隊列中;從所述隊列中獲取所述數據,并將所述數據發送到所述第二服務器;判斷所述數據是否成功發送到所述第二服務器;在所述數據發送失敗時,重新從所述隊列中獲取所述數據并進行發送。
依據本發明的再一個方面,提供了一種數據傳輸裝置,其包括:數據接收模塊,用于在第一服務器所處的地理位置,接收來自所述第一服務器的待發送至第二服務器的數據,所述第二服務器和所述第一服務器位于不同地理位置;隊列存放模塊,用于將所述數據存放到預設的隊列中;數據發送模塊,用于從所述隊列中獲取所述數據,并將所述數據發送到所述第二服務器;判斷模塊,用于判斷所述數據是否成功發送到所述第二服務器;在所述數據發送失敗時,所述數據發送模塊重新從所述隊列中獲取所述數據并進行發送。
依據本發明的再一個方面,提供了一種服務器,其包括:前述的數據傳輸裝置。
根據以上技術方案,可知本發明的數據傳輸方法、裝置和服務器至少具有以下優點:
根據本發明的技術方案中,在第一服務器所處的地理位置接收第一服務器的數據,由于地理位置相同所以數據傳輸可以不經過公網網絡,所以可以保證接收的數據完全準確;將數據向第二服務器發送時,由于數據通過隊列進行了緩存,所以即使數據沒有成功發送到第二服務器,也可以從隊列中獲取數據重新進行發送,直至發送成功為止,可知本發明的技術方案可以有效地防止出現數據丟失的情況。
上述說明僅是本發明技術方案的概述,為了能夠更清楚了解本發明的技術手段,而可依照說明書的內容予以實施,并且為了讓本發明的上述和其它目的、特征和優點能夠更明顯易懂,以下特舉本發明的具體實施方式。
附圖說明
通過閱讀下文優選實施方式的詳細描述,各種其他的優點和益處對于本領域普通技術人員將變得清楚明了。附圖僅用于示出優選實施方式的目的,而并不認為是對本發明的限制。而且在整個附圖中,用相同的參考符號表示相同的部件。在附圖中:
圖1示出了本發明的一個實施例的數據傳輸方法的流程圖;
圖2示出了本發明的一個實施例的數據傳輸方法的流程圖;
圖3示出了本發明的一個實施例的數據傳輸方法的流程圖;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京奇虎科技有限公司;奇智軟件(北京)有限公司,未經北京奇虎科技有限公司;奇智軟件(北京)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410746563.5/2.html,轉載請聲明來源鉆瓜專利網。





